A lot of clouds during my observing session this morning, resulting in variable seeing conditions.  Today the Solar activity is Very Low with no flares in the last two days despite the large active region AR2585.  Its area covers 590 millionths of the 690 for the total of the disk.   Total spot count for today is 16.  Full disk images today with close ups of AR2585 and 86  as well as the nice filament.
